- Texas agriculture officials are keeping a close eye on the Mexican border after a recent screwworm case was found about 70 miles from Laredo. The case was discovered Sept.
21 in Nuevo León, Mexico, and while officials say it’s not a reason to panic, people, especially cattle owners and deer hunters, need to be paying attention.
